Command
Options Function & Description
B1 *
Select Bell 212A for 1200 bps
connection and Bell 103 for 300 bps
B2
Select V.23 1200 bps for receiving, 75
bps for transmitting in originate mode;
75 bps for receiving and 1200 bps for
transmitting in answer mode
B3
Select V.23 75 bps for receiving, 1200
bps for transmitting in originate mode;
1200 bps for receiving and 75 bps for
transmitting in answer mode
Dn
Dial command, beginning the dialing
sequence. The string “n” (telephone
number and modifiers) listed as
follows is entered after the “D”
command
P
Pulse dial. Only digits 0 to 9 can be
dialed
R
Reverse dial. Originate call in answer
mode (go on-line in answer mode)
Sn
Dial the phone number stored in
NVRAM at location “n” (n=0, 1, 2, 3)
T
DTMF tone dial. Any digit 0 to 9, *, #,
A, B, C… may be dialed as a tone
W
Wait for second dial tone. The modem
waits for the second dial tone before
processing the dial string
,
Pause. Cause the modem to pause for
a time before processing the dial string
(designed by S8 register)
!
Flash hook (for call transfer). Cause
the modem to go on-hook for 0.5
second then return off-hook
@
Wait for 5 seconds of silence after
dialing number
;
Return to command state after dialing
a number without disconnecting the
call
* Factory default setting
